Happy New Year! I hope everyone had a wonderful holiday season and is looking forward to a fresh start in 2012!  I am excited to kick off a new year and share one of my family's favorite recipes for Italian Cream Cake.  This is a family recipe that has been around for as long as I can remember and one that we always enjoy around the holidays, especially the winter months.  With winter around for a little while longer and still a chance of snow for some of you that live in colder climates I thought this recipe would be perfect baked as individual cakes to resemble snowballs.
